Le Bandit Hold & Win Slot Review
Written by: Filip Gromovic Reviewed by: Nashon Khamala
Updated: Aug 2026
Le Bandit Hold & Win is a 3-reel, 3-row slot from Hacksaw Gaming that strips the original Le Bandit down to a compact 9-payline format. Released on September 15, 2026, this sequel replaces the 6×5 cluster pays grid and Golden Squares mechanic with two distinct Hold & Win bonus rounds built around Coin symbols, Jackpot Markers, and Pot of Gold collectors.
The highest RTP configuration is 96.27%, with medium volatility rated 3 out of 5 on Hacksaw’s internal scale. A max win of 2,500× through the Grand fixed jackpot makes this a lower-ceiling title compared to its predecessor, but the wide bet range of $0.05 to $400 and a 35.67% hit frequency offer a more balanced session profile.
Theme & Design: Smokey’s Parisian Heist in Miniature
Le Bandit Hold & Win returns to the sepia-toned Parisian alleyway from the original 2023 title. Smokey the raccoon stands in his usual corner, crowbar in hand, while an upbeat ragtime piano track plays in the background. The cartoon art style, complete with baguettes and bear traps as pay symbols, mirrors the vintage animation feel of the first Le Bandit release.
The key visual difference is the reduced play area. Instead of the 6×5 grid with 30 symbol positions, only 9 positions fill the screen. This smaller layout makes Coin values, Jackpot Markers, and Clover multipliers easy to track during the Hold & Win rounds, where multiple special symbols can appear simultaneously. Animations remain short and the grid refreshes without delay between spins.
How to Play Le Bandit Hold & Win
The slot runs on a straightforward 3×3 grid with 9 fixed paylines that pay left to right. Only three-of-a-kind (3 OAK) combinations register as wins. Regular symbol payouts are settled first, then any Coin or Jackpot Marker wins are resolved afterward.
Here is how to set up a spin:
- Adjust your stake using the +/- buttons. The range is $0.05 to $400 per spin.
- Press Spin to fill the 3×3 grid.
- Watch for 3 OAK symbol combinations along the 9 paylines.
- After regular wins settle, any 3+ Coin or Jackpot Marker symbols on the grid pay their values.
- A Rainbow or Epic Rainbow scatter triggers a Hold & Win bonus round.
- Use Autoplay or Turbo/Super Turbo modes from the menu for faster sessions.
Here is an overview of the core specifications:
| Feature | Details |
| Grid Size | 3×3 |
| Pay System | 9 fixed paylines (left to right) |
| Winning Combination | 3 of a kind |
| Stake Range | $0.05 to $400 |
| Hit Frequency | 35.67% |
| Bonus Trigger | Rainbow or Epic Rainbow scatter |
| Max Win | 2,500× (Grand Jackpot) |
Symbols & Payouts
Le Bandit Hold & Win uses only five regular pay symbols, split between two tiers. No wild symbol is present in this game, which puts more weight on the Coin and Jackpot Marker mechanics for generating value beyond standard payline wins.
| Symbol | Type | 3 OAK Payout |
| Top Hat | High-pay | 3× |
| Baguette Bag | High-pay | 1× – 3× |
| Bear Trap | High-pay | 1× – 3× |
| A | Low-pay | 0.2× |
| K | Low-pay | 0.2× |
The narrow payout range on regular symbols (0.2× to 3×) reflects the fact that most meaningful returns come from the Hold & Win rounds rather than base-game paylines. With a 35.67% hit frequency, roughly one in three spins produces some form of payout, but the amounts tend to be small outside of bonus rounds.
Bonus Features
All of the slot’s upside is concentrated in its Hold & Win mechanics. There are no traditional free spins, no wild substitutions, and no gamble feature. Instead, two Hold & Win variants, Coin reveals, Jackpot Markers, Clover multipliers, and Pot of Gold collectors form the complete feature set.
Coins & Jackpot Markers
When three or more Coins, Jackpot Markers, or any combination of both land on the grid during a single spin, their values are paid after regular payline wins. Coins appear in three tiers: Bronze (0.2×–2×), Silver (3×–9×), and Gold (10×–50×). These values apply both in the base game and inside the Hold & Win rounds.
Jackpot Markers award one of four fixed prizes displayed above the reels:
| Jackpot | Payout |
| Mini | 5× |
| Major | 25× |
| Mega | 250× |
| Grand | 2,500× (max win) |
These are fixed, non-progressive jackpots. The Grand at 2,500× represents the slot’s maximum possible payout from a single round.
Rainbow Fortune Hold & Win
Landing a single Rainbow scatter triggers the Rainbow Fortune Hold & Win round. It begins with 3 lives (not traditional spins). Only Coins, Jackpot Markers, Pot of Gold, Clover, and dead symbols can appear on the reels during this feature.
Each time a non-dead special symbol lands, it sticks in place and the life count resets to 3. Clover symbols activate at the end of the round, multiplying all Coin and activated Pot of Gold values by 2× to 20×. If a Pot of Gold lands, it collects every Coin and previously activated Pot of Gold value on the grid, stores them, and removes the collected Coins from the reels.
A full grid of special symbols triggers an automatic reveal-and-payout cycle: all Coins reveal, Clovers activate, Jackpot Markers resolve, and all values are paid before the grid clears for the next spin. When lives run out, remaining values on the grid are paid and the feature ends.
Rainbow Epic Drop Hold & Win
An Epic Rainbow scatter activates this variant. The mechanics are identical to Rainbow Fortune Hold & Win, with one key difference: the round starts with a full 3×3 grid already populated with special symbols, including at least one Coin worth 1× or more and at least one Pot of Gold.
Because the grid begins fully loaded, the first cycle of Clover activations and Pot of Gold collections happens immediately. This makes the Epic Drop variant the higher-value entry point into the Hold & Win system, which is also reflected in its FeatureSpins price.
FeatureSpins (Bonus Buy)
Players in jurisdictions that allow bonus buy can purchase direct entry into either Hold & Win round:
| FeatureSpin Option | Cost | What You Get |
| Rainbow Fortune Hold & Win | 35× bet | Standard Hold & Win trigger with 3 lives |
| Rainbow Epic Drop Hold & Win | 100× bet | Full grid of special symbols from the start |
At 100× the stake, the Epic Drop buy-in is a significant investment. Players who prefer to control session cost should note that neither FeatureSpin option changes the RTP in any meaningful way, as the highest FeatureSpin RTP is 96.27%, matching the base game’s top setting.
RTP & Volatility of Le Bandit Hold & Win
The return to player value of Le Bandit Hold & Win reaches 96.27% at its highest configuration. However, Hacksaw Gaming offers operators four distinct RTP settings, and the version running at any given casino may differ. The four options are 96.27%, 94.29%, 92.23%, and 86.28%. Checking the in-game info panel before depositing is the only reliable way to confirm which version is active.
The gap between the highest and lowest setting is nearly 10 percentage points, which makes a measurable difference over extended sessions. The 96.27% top setting sits slightly above the commonly cited 96% industry baseline.
| Metric | Value |
| RTP (highest) | 96.27% |
| RTP (all settings) | 96.27% / 94.29% / 92.23% / 86.28% |
| Volatility | Medium (3/5) |
| Hit Frequency | 35.67% |
| Max Win | 2,500× |
Medium volatility with a 35.67% hit rate means roughly a third of spins return something. Most of those returns are small base-game payline hits. The larger payouts depend on the Hold & Win rounds connecting with high-value Coins, Jackpot Markers, and Clover multipliers stacking together.

Conclusion: Who Will Enjoy Le Bandit Hold & Win
Le Bandit Hold & Win suits players who prefer compact, jackpot-focused slots with a medium-risk profile. The 35.67% hit frequency keeps sessions active, the four fixed jackpots give a clear target structure, and the Clover multipliers (2×–20×) add meaningful upside to the Hold & Win rounds. With a 96.27% top RTP and stakes from $0.05, it is accessible for budget-conscious players, while the $400 maximum bet accommodates larger wagers.
Those who prefer the original Le Bandit's 6×5 cluster pays layout and its 10,000× ceiling may find the 3×3 format restrictive. The 2,500× max win is modest by Hacksaw Gaming's standards, and the absence of wild symbols limits base-game variety. Fans of multi-payline or Megaways-style mechanics will not find those here.
